Description Ascaridole (NSC-406266) acts as an anthelmintic compound that repels parasitic helminths (worms) in humans and plants and has weak antimalarial activity.
Synonyms NSC-406266, NSC 406266, NSC406266
molecular weight 168.23
Molecular formula C10H16O2
CAS 512-85-6
Storage keep away from direct sunlight | Powder: -20°C for 3 years | In solvent: -80°C for 1 year
Solubility DMSO: 55 mg/mL (326.93 mM)
